What type of hacker is typically motivated by political or religious beliefs?

Explanation:
The type of hacker typically motivated by political or religious beliefs is cyber terrorists. This category of hackers engages in cyber activities that are intended to cause disruption, fear, or harm, driven by their ideological convictions. Cyber terrorism can involve attacks on critical infrastructure, stealing confidential information, or distributing propaganda, all designed to promote specific political or religious agendas. White hat hackers focus on ethical hacking and securing systems, often working to prevent attacks rather than instigating them. Script kiddies are less concerned with any ideological beliefs; they utilize readily available tools and scripts to perform hacking without a deep understanding of the underlying systems. Black hat hackers act maliciously for personal gain or to exploit vulnerabilities, rather than being motivated by a specific political or religious cause. This distinction highlights the unique nature of cyber terrorists, who use hacking as a means to further their ideological beliefs.
